On the connection between the ABS perturbation methodology and differential privacy. (arXiv:2303.13771v1 [cs.IT])
cs.CR updates on arXiv.org arxiv.org
This paper explores analytical connections between the perturbation
methodology of the Australian Bureau of Statistics (ABS) and the differential
privacy (DP) framework. We consider a single static counting query function and
find the analytical form of the perturbation distribution with symmetric
support for the ABS perturbation methodology. We then analytically measure the
DP parameters, namely the $(\varepsilon, \delta)$ pair, for the ABS
perturbation methodology under this setting. The results and insights obtained
